80-Year-Old Gets DUI After 2nd Crash At Crash Scene in Glastonbury
Glastonbury police said a suspected drunken driver caused a second accident at a crash investigation.

GLASTONBURY, CT — An 80-year-old suspected drunken driver caused a second accident at an Glastonbury accident scene, police said.
Glastonbury police released details of the Oct. 14 incident this week.
At 7:15 p.m. that day, while police were investigating a separate crash, the elderly Glastonbury resident traveled through the accident scene, but then hit one of the vehicles involved, according to an arrest report.

She was subsequently stopped by an officer and then failed standardized field sobriety tests. She was taken into custody, released on $20,000 non-surety bond and is scheduled to appear in Manchester Superior Court on Nov. 9.
